Markdown是一种轻量级标记语言,它允许人们使用易读易写的纯文本格式编写文档,然后转换成格式丰富的HTML页面。在Markdown中,代码块的编写能够让文档中的代码更清晰、更专业。下面,我将为你详细介绍如何轻松入门Markdown代码块的编写。
1. 代码块的基本语法
Markdown中的代码块可以通过两种方式创建:
1.1 使用反引号
在代码块前后各添加三个反引号(`),即可创建一个简单的代码块。例如:
这是一个简单的代码块。
1.2 使用Tab键或空格
在代码块前后各添加一个Tab键或四个空格,也可以创建一个代码块。例如:
这是一个使用Tab键创建的代码块。
2. 代码块的语法高亮
Markdown支持多种编程语言的语法高亮。要实现语法高亮,需要在代码块的第一行添加一个特殊的声明,指定代码的语言类型。例如:
```python
print("Hello, world!")
上面的代码块使用了Python语言,因此会自动应用Python的语法高亮。
3. 代码块的缩进
在某些情况下,你可能需要调整代码块的缩进,以适应文档的排版需求。这可以通过在代码块前添加多个空格或Tab键来实现。例如:
print("这是一个缩进的代码块。")
4. 代码块的引用
如果你需要在文档中引用代码块,可以使用引用标记。例如:
这是一个引用的代码块:
```python
print("这是一个引用的代码块。")
5. 代码块与表格的结合
Markdown允许你将代码块与表格结合使用,以展示更丰富的信息。例如:
| 语言 | 语法高亮示例 |
| ---- | ------------ |
| Python | ```python
print("Python 语法高亮")
``` |
| JavaScript | ```javascript
console.log("JavaScript 语法高亮");
``` |
| HTML | ```html
<!DOCTYPE html>
<html>
<head>
<title>HTML 语法高亮</title>
</head>
<body>
<h1>这是一个HTML代码块</h1>
</body>
</html>
``` |
## 6. 代码块与列表的结合
Markdown还允许你将代码块与列表结合使用,以展示代码和对应的解释。例如:
```markdown
- Python
```python
print("Python 代码示例")
- JavaScript
console.log("JavaScript 代码示例");
总结
掌握Markdown代码块的编写,可以让你的文档更加专业、易读。通过本文的介绍,相信你已经对Markdown代码块的编写有了初步的了解。在实际应用中,不断练习和积累,你将能够熟练运用Markdown代码块,让你的文档更加出色。
